I also hate the Sex Pistols. I love late 70s/early 80s british punk, but the Sex Pistols were basically a boy band (the members were "collected" by Malcolm McLaren, originally to form a band for the former lead singer of the New York Dolls), and basically just tried to be controversial instead of making good music. Thank God for the Clash! |
